In this paper the production cross section pp → (γ, Z) → ν τντ γ + X in pp collisions at √ s = 8, 13, 14, 33 T eV is presented. Furthermore, we estimate bounds at the 95% C.L. on the dipole moments of the tau-neutrino using integrated luminosity of L = 20, 50, 100, 200, 500, 1000, 3000 f b −1 collected with the ATLAS detector at the LHC and we consider systematic uncertainties of δ sys = 0, 5, 10 %. It is shown that the process under consideration is a good prospect for probing the dipole moments of the tau-neutrino at the LHC.
